The most expensive public transport journey in the world

London Transport has increased its fares from the start of 2007.

This means that the 'walk-up' fare for a single journey in the centre of London costs £4. If you travel between Leicester Square and Covent Garden stations - one stop, but you would be surprised how many people do it - the distance is only 0.16 miles or 0.26 km, the shortest distance between any two tube stations (Of course, you can't tell this from the schematic map).

This works out at £25 or $48.2 per mile, or EUR 22.8 per km.

Anything more expensive out there? ("Normal" transport modes, so not including ski-lifts or similar; and to make the comparison fair, for air travel full Y-class fares).
